A subspace method for frequency selective identification of stochastic systems

IFAC Proceedings Volumes, 2008
A parametric method for the estimation of vector valued discrete-time stochastic systems or equivalently the spectrum of a stochastic process is presented. The key feature is that the method can be used to frequency selectively fit the model to the data.

Reference based stochastic subspace identification in civil engineering

Inverse Problems in Engineering, 2000
A specific strategy is required when performing vibration tests on civil engineering structures. The use of artificial excitation sources such as shakers or drop weights is often unpractical and expensive. Ambient excitation on the contrary is freely available (traffic, wind), but it causes other challenges.
